Mr. Johnson Art 2D/3D Comprehensive 3D Comp 1

 A Subtractive Sculpture is – Formed by incising excessive material away from a block, leaving the finished work.  ( Also known as a carving.)

 Was an English sculptor, best know for his monumental bronze sculptures…  He was the worlds most celebrated sculptor of his time.

 Was a Romanian born sculptor who made his career in France. Considered the pioneer of modernism.

 She was an English Sculptor who’s work exemplifies modernism.  Her work is another fine example of the modern art movement in the mid 20 th century.

 Create an abstract, subtractive sculpture from your block of Styrofoam.  This abstract sculpture must display form, movement, and tension.  1. create a sketch of your finished piece.  2. What is your inspiration for this piece?  3. Create a clay Marquette of the finished piece so you have a model to guide your carving.  4. Begin subtracting material from your block using trim tools found in our 3-D lab.
